Exploring Top VMware Alternatives: A Guide to Virtualization

The main VMware alternatives include:

  • Microsoft Hyper-V: Ideal for Windows-centric environments.
  • Citrix Hypervisor: Strong in virtual desktop infrastructure.
  • Red Hat Virtualization (RHV): Suited for Linux-based deployments.
  • Oracle VM: Optimized for Oracle applications.
  • Proxmox VE: Combines VM and container management.
  • Nutanix AHV: Simplifies hyper-converged infrastructure management.

Introduction to VMware Alternatives

vmware alternatives

In the dynamic sphere of virtualization technology, VMware has long been a towering figure synonymous with innovation and reliability.

However, the evolving landscape of IT infrastructure demands a nuanced examination of what lies beyond the VMware ecos system.

  • What is VMware’s intrinsic role in virtualization technology? VMware, a global leader in cloud infrastructure and digital workspace technology, revolutionizes how enterprises manage and deploy software. Its virtualization solutions are known for their robustness, but this comes with a cost and complexity that may not align with every organization’s needs.
  • Why are businesses and individuals exploring VMware alternatives? The reasons vary – from budget constraints and the need for specific features to scalability requirements and open-source preferences. This diversity in demands necessitates a look at alternatives that could offer a better fit for different scenarios.
  • How do the alternatives stack up against VMware’s offerings? We aim to provide an unbiased, comprehensive view of the virtualization landscape, considering factors like cost-effectiveness, customization, user experience, and technological adaptability.

Understanding Virtualization Technology

Virtualization technology is a cornerstone of modern IT infrastructure, enabling efficient utilization of resources and greater flexibility in managing hardware and software environments.

At its core, virtualization involves:

  • Creating Virtual Environments: This is achieved by abstracting hardware elements – such as CPU, memory, and storage – to create multiple virtual machines (VMs) from a single physical machine. Each VM operates independently and can run its operating system and applications.
  • Enhanced Resource Management: By pooling hardware resources, virtualization allows for better scalability and agility in deploying and managing IT resources. This is crucial in today’s rapidly changing business environments.

The key features of virtualization software typically include:

  • Hypervisor Technology: This software layer enables the creation and management of VMs. Ensuring each VM remains isolated and secure while sharing the underlying physical resources is crucial.
  • High Availability and Disaster Recovery: Essential for ensuring business continuity, these features enable quick recovery from hardware failures and data loss.
  • Scalability and Performance Management: Virtualization software must efficiently manage resources and scale up or down according to workload demands.
  • Security and Compliance: With data breaches becoming increasingly common, robust security features are non-negotiable in virtualization software.
  • Ease of Use and Management: A user-friendly interface and simplified management tools are vital for reducing complexity and operational costs.

Through this exploration, we aim to illuminate the landscape of virtualization technology, providing clarity and insight into the alternatives to VMware.

This understanding is crucial for businesses and individuals as they navigate the myriad choices in the virtualization market.

Top Alternatives to VMware

Exploring the diverse virtualization landscape, we uncover notable alternatives to VMware, each offering unique features and advantages.

This analysis provides an informed perspective on how these solutions differ from VMware in critical areas like features, pricing, and user experience.

Especially in light of VMware being acquired by Broadcom and the stop of selling licenses.

  • Microsoft Hyper-V: Known for its integration with Windows Server environments.
    • Key Features: Strong support for Windows VMs, scalability, and live migration.
    • Pricing: Part of Windows Server, cost-effective for Microsoft ecosystem users.
    • User Experience: Familiar for Windows users, may have a learning curve for others.
  • Citrix Hypervisor (formerly XenServer): A versatile open-source platform.
    • Key Features: Excellent for VDI open-source customization.
    • Pricing: Cost-effective open-source solution; paid versions for enterprise features.
    • User Experience: Strong in VDI, requires technical expertise.
  • Red Hat Virtualization (RHV): Linux-centric, based on KVM technology.
    • Key Features: Strong security scalability, suited for large-scale Linux deployments.
    • Pricing: Subscription model, competitive for enterprise-level support.
    • User Experience: It integrates well with Red Hat products but is less familiar to non-Linux users.
  • Oracle VM: Tailored for Oracle products but versatile.
    • Key Features: Optimizes Oracle applications and supports other workloads.
    • Pricing: No additional cost for Oracle customers.
    • User Experience: Highly integrated for Oracle users.
  • Proxmox VE: Manages both VMs and containers.
    • Key Features: Unified VM and container management, strong in storage and networking.
    • Pricing: Free, open-source tool with paid support options.
    • User Experience: Accessible web-based management, less intuitive for VMware users.
  • Nutanix AHV: A key player in hyper-converged infrastructure.
    • Key Features: Simplifies computing, storage, and networking management and integrates well with the Nutanix ecosystem.
    • Pricing: Part of the Nutanix infrastructure stack, offering a bundled solution.
    • User Experience: Known for its user-friendly interface and ease of use, particularly in hyper-converged environments.

Each of these alternatives brings distinctive benefits to the table. Their suitability largely depends on specific requests.

How to Choose the Right Virtualization Software

Selecting the right virtualization software is a critical decision that hinges on various factors.

Here’s a guide to help you assess your needs and make an informed choice:

  1. Compatibility with Existing Infrastructure:
    • Ensure the software aligns with your current hardware and OS environments.
    • Consider the ease of integration with your existing systems and applications.
  2. Scalability and Performance Needs:
    • Evaluate how well the software can grow with your business.
    • Assess performance metrics, especially for resource-intensive applications.
  3. Support and Community Ecosystem:
    • Investigate the level of support and documentation available.
    • Consider the strength and activity of the user and developer community for troubleshooting and best practices.
  4. Budgetary Considerations:
    • Compare the cost of licenses, support, and potential hardware upgrades.
    • Consider long-term operational costs, including maintenance and training.
  5. Security Features and Compliance Requirements:
    • Review the security measures and compliance certifications of the software.
    • Ensure it meets your industry-specific security and regulatory needs.
  6. Ease of Use and Management:
    • Consider the learning curve and the ease of day-to-day management.
    • Evaluate the availability of management tools and automation features.
  7. Vendor Reputation and Reliability:
    • Research the vendor’s track record in the market.
    • Consider factors like vendor stability, customer service, and innovation history.

This checklist is a starting point for your decision-making process, guiding you toward a virtualization solution that meets your current requirements and supports your future growth and technological evolution.

Industry Use Cases

The application of virtualization technology transcends various industries, each leveraging it to enhance efficiency, agility, and innovation.

We examine how different sectors utilize virtualization tools and instances where alternatives to VMware might offer distinct advantages.

  • Healthcare: Hospitals and healthcare providers use virtualization to manage patient records and critical applications. In scenarios demanding specialized compliance and data protection, solutions like Red Hat Virtualization, known for its robust security features, might be more advantageous than VMware.
  • Education: Educational institutions often require cost-effective solutions for managing their IT infrastructure. Open-source platforms like Proxmox VE or Citrix Hypervisor can offer substantial savings, making them a practical choice over VMware in budget-sensitive environments.
  • Finance and Banking: The finance sector relies on virtualization for high-performance computing and secure data processing. Oracle VM can be particularly beneficial in this industry, especially for businesses already operating within the Oracle ecosystem, offering seamless integration and optimized performance.
  • Retail: Retail businesses use virtualization for inventory management, point-of-sale systems, and e-commerce platforms. With its strong Windows integration, Microsoft Hyper-V can be a more suitable option for retail businesses heavily reliant on Windows-based applications.
  • Manufacturing: In manufacturing, virtualization manages supply chain operations and production processes. The scalability and performance management capabilities of alternatives like Red Hat Virtualization or Oracle VM can offer more tailored solutions in resource-intensive environments.

Understanding each industry’s specific needs and challenges is crucial in selecting a virtualization solution that meets the immediate requirements and aligns with long-term strategic goals.

Best Practices in Selecting and Using Virtualization Software

Choosing and implementing the right virtualization software is a critical process that requires careful planning and execution.

Here are essential best practices and common pitfalls to avoid:

  • Conduct a Thorough Needs Analysis: Understand your specific requirements regarding performance, scalability, security, and budget. Avoid choosing a solution based solely on market popularity or vendor persuasion.
  • Plan for Scalability and Future Growth: Ensure that the virtualization solution can scale with your business. Overlooking future scalability can lead to costly migrations or upgrades later.
  • Invest in Training and Knowledge Building: Virtualization technologies can be complex, and inadequate training can lead to underutilization or misuse. Proper training for your IT staff is crucial.
  • Focus on Security and Compliance: Prioritize security features and ensure compliance with industry regulations. Neglecting security aspects can have severe consequences, especially in data-sensitive industries.
  • Regularly Review and Optimize Your Virtualization Environment: Continuous monitoring and optimizing your virtualization setup can significantly improve performance and efficiency. Failure to regularly review can lead to resource wastage and operational inefficiencies.
  • Have a Robust Backup and Disaster Recovery Plan: Ensure your virtualization solution includes effective backup and disaster recovery capabilities. Overlooking this aspect can be catastrophic for data loss or system failures.
  • Seek Community and Vendor Support: Leverage the knowledge and experience of the community and vendor support. Ignoring these resources can lead to missed opportunities for optimizing and troubleshooting your environment.

By adhering to these best practices and being aware of common pitfalls, organizations can maximize the benefits of their virtualization software, ensuring a secure, efficient, and scalable IT environment.

Future of Virtualization Technology

The horizon of virtualization technology is continually expanding, shaped by innovations and evolving business needs.

Key trends influencing this landscape include:

  • Increased Adoption of Cloud Services: The integration of cloud computing with virtualization is becoming more seamless. This shift means users will increasingly seek solutions that offer easy cloud migration and hybrid cloud capabilities.
  • Rise of Containerization: Containers are gaining traction as they provide a lightweight alternative to traditional VMs, especially in DevOps environments. This trend might influence users to opt for solutions like Proxmox VE, which offers both VM and container management.
  • Enhanced Focus on Security: As cyber threats evolve, so do the security requirements of virtualization platforms. Users will gravitate towards solutions that offer advanced security features and compliance with the latest standards.
  • Edge Computing: The growth of edge computing demands virtualization solutions that can operate efficiently in decentralized environments. This development could shift preference towards more agile and lightweight virtualization tools.

These changes are not just shaping the technology itself but also how users make decisions.

Flexibility, security, cloud-readiness, and ease of management are becoming pivotal factors in choosing the right virtualization solution.


  • Q: What are the main advantages of using alternatives to VMware?
    • A: Alternatives often provide cost savings, specialized features, better integration with specific ecosystems, and, sometimes, more flexibility in terms of licensing and usage.
  • Q: How do open-source alternatives compare to VMware in terms of support and reliability?
    • A: Open-source alternatives often have active community support and can be reliable. However, they may require more in-house expertise than VMware, which offers comprehensive professional support.
  • Q: Can I migrate from VMware to another virtualization platform easily?
    • A: Migration is possible but can be complex, depending on the specifics of your environment and the platform you are moving to. It’s advisable to plan thoroughly and, if possible, consult with experts.
  • Q: Are VMware alternatives suitable for large enterprises?
    • A: Yes, many alternatives like Microsoft Hyper-V and Red Hat Virtualization are well-equipped to handle the demands of large enterprises.
  • Q: Is it more cost-effective to use an alternative to VMware?
    • A: It can be, especially if the alternative aligns better with your existing infrastructure or specific needs. However, cost should not be the only factor in making a decision.


In exploring the virtualization landscape and the alternatives to VMware, we’ve traversed various aspects from industry use cases to future trends. Key takeaways include:

  • Diverse Options: Many alternatives are available, each with strengths and specialties.
  • Aligning with Needs: The best choice depends on your specific requirements, existing infrastructure, and future growth plans.
  • Informed Decision-Making: Understanding the evolving landscape of virtualization technology is crucial in making an informed choice.

When selecting a virtualization solution, we encourage our readers to consider their unique needs, industry-specific requirements, and long-term IT strategies.

The right choice addresses your challenges and positions you to capitalize on future technological advancements.

Remember, in the dynamic world of IT, adaptability and informed decision-making are vital to staying ahead.


  • Fredrik Filipsson

    Fredrik Filipsson brings two decades of Oracle license management experience, including a nine-year tenure at Oracle and 11 years in Oracle license consulting. His expertise extends across leading IT corporations like IBM, enriching his profile with a broad spectrum of software and cloud projects. Filipsson's proficiency encompasses IBM, SAP, Microsoft, and Salesforce platforms, alongside significant involvement in Microsoft Copilot and AI initiatives, improving organizational efficiency.

    View all posts